Well, if you want to get Soul Vortex going with a D2 commander you are probably better served by giving it a Death gem to spend when casting it, as the skull staff is a poor weapon and the skullface is way too expensive.

The problem with the Spirit is more that it compares unfavorably with all the other Tartarians. At 150 hit points, it has the lowest hit point base. 8 action points makes it very slow on the battle field, magnified by its lack of a feet slot. Titans and Cyclops have the standard humanoid item slots making them better SCs and they have far better paths making them easy to give priority.

The real choice is between the Monstra and the Spirit - the Spirit has a body slot which the Monstra lacks. The Monstra, however, has 46.666...% percent more hp (220 to 150) and entirely random magic and more paths than even the female titan to boot, making it a better choice to GoR.

Further, the Monstra is really poor as a standard unit, only having fist attacks. The spirit has the rather decent Tartarian Chains attack and some regeneration, making its baseline fairly capable in combat. Remember that the Spirit also starts with poor amphibian, unlike other Tartarians - you could take them as troops beneath the waves while other Tartarians fights your land-battles.
I agree, the Monstra sounds better to GoR. But the Spirit seems to me to not suck when GoRed and be superior to the Monstrum as a commander.

So it look like it would be (Titan, A/E Cyclops), then (Titaness, E Cyclops), then Monstra, then Spirit, then Monstrum.
